Maladroit Explorer Grind — Plexi Punch & Unrestrained Lead

Rivers Cuomo described the Maladroit sessions as cleaner and more defined than the Green Album, using a plexi Marshall and spending more time experimenting with guitar tones; equipment histories also associate the record with a Gibson Explorer and Marshall JCM2000. Exact song controls are not available, so the settings below approximate that documented hard-rock setup. Source: Guitar Player’s July 2002 Rivers Cuomo interview and Weezerpedia’s equipment history.

Notes

Keep the riff dry and punchy, with strong midrange and limited bass. The lead can be louder and brighter, but should still sound like the same cranked Marshall family.
